摘要
目的:探讨姜黄素对人宫颈癌裸鼠皮下移植瘤淋巴管生成及淋巴道转移的影响。方法:取对数生长期Ca Ski细胞接种于裸鼠右腋窝皮下,建立人宫颈癌裸鼠皮下移植瘤模型,免疫组化方法检测移植瘤组织中VEGF-C和VEGFR-3蛋白表达情况。结果:免疫组化显示姜黄素处理组的肿瘤组织VEGF-C、VEGFR-3蛋白表达水平较阴性对照组降低(P<0.05)。可见姜黄素能下调肿瘤细胞中VEGF-C和VEGFR-3蛋白的表达。结论:姜黄素具有抗宫颈癌淋巴管生成的作用,对宫颈癌淋巴道转移具有抑制作用,其主要机制与抑制VEGF-C和VEGFR-3蛋白的表达有关。
Objective:To study the effects of curcumin on lymphangiogenesis and lymphatic metastasis of human cervical cancer subcutaneous xenograft in nude mice tube. Methods:To take the logarithmic growth phase of CaSki cells and inoculate them in nude mice right axillary subcutaneous,establish the model of human cervical carcinoma subcutaneous xenograft in nude mice and test VEGF - C and VEGFR - 3 protein in transplanted tumor by immunohis-tochemical method. Results:Immunohistochemical method showed that compared with the control group,expressions of VEGF - C and VEGFR - 3 in transplanted tumors were downregulated in curcumin groups. Curcumin can cut down the expression of VEGF - C and VEGFR - 3 protein in tumor cells. Conclusion:Curcumin has a significant anti -lymphangiogenesis activity. Curcumin has an inhibitory effect on the cervical lymph node metastasis,which may be re-lated with the inhibition expression of VEGF - C and VEGFR - 3.
